State of the Markets 2024: A Conversation with Dan Tolomay

In this episode of Trust Company Talks, hosts Burke Koonce and Bill Noble are joined by Trust Company's chief investment officer, Dan Tolomay, to discuss the current state of the markets. Together, the trio explores market conditions, the impact of the Federal Reserve and China’s role in the global economy. Specifically, they discuss: * Benefits of data-driven, long-term investing and the significant impact the top 10 S&P Index stocks had on its performance. * The unpredictability and high valuations of large-cap growth stocks. * The transformative role of the Federal Reserve in shaping investment landscapes and the potential effects of interest rate shifts and quantitative easing. * Emerging markets and the potential consequences of China's economic bubble, especially in real estate. * The enduring appeal of value investing and the delicate balance between risk and reward. They discuss the importance of diversification amidst market volatility and why they prefer taking compensated risks as opposed to "putting all your eggs in one basket." Overall, Dan expressed confidence in Trust Company's investing approach and strategic positioning, underlining the importance of a thoughtful, well-diversified portfolio to preserve and grow wealth. The Power of Collaborative Giving: A Conversation with Gavin Stevens of The Alamance Community Foundation

In this episode of Trust Company Talks, we sat down with Gavin Stevens, executive director at Alamance Community Foundation (ACF), an organization dedicated to strengthening Alamance County through inspired and collaborative giving. The foundation was established in 1991 in Burlington, North Carolina, and, as a long-term partner, Trust Company of the South has had the pleasure of witnessing the organization's impact on the Alamance community first-hand. Throughout the conversation, they discuss ACF's history and role in collective giving and supporting community needs. The foundation serves as a hub for connecting donors with causes and providing support, including helping individuals who want to support the community but are unsure about specific needs. They also discuss Alamance County's unique position as a rapidly growing area with diverse economic development and how the foundation is crucial in addressing challenges arising from this growth, such as shortages in early childcare services. Additionally, Gavin shares her thoughts on the transfer of wealth and the need for intentional, long-term planning in the non-profit community. She also shares the impact of inflation on charitable giving and ACF's strategies for navigating these economic challenges. Community foundations play a vital role in fostering collaboration, addressing community needs and creating a lasting impact through strategic philanthropy. Optimizing Portfolios in Unpredictable Times: A Conversation with Edward Saracino of Vanguard

In this episode of Trust Company Talks, hosts Bill Noble and Burke Koonce are joined by Edward Saracino, senior portfolio specialist with Vanguard Financial Advisor Services, a longstanding investment partner of Trust Company of the South. During the conversation, Noble, Koonce and Saracino share insights on the current financial market, the pros and cons of different types of portfolio construction, and Vanguard's role as a resource to Trust Company clients.
